Factors Affecting Cost
Wood window installation in Carlisle, MA, involves selecting appropriate materials, assessing the scope of work, and understanding local permitting requirements. This overview provides a neutral summary of typical project considerations to help compare options and estimate costs.
- Materials: Commonly used woods include pine, oak, and cedar,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
- Size and Scope: Projects may range from replacing a single window to installing multiple units across a home, with sizes varying from small casement windows to large picture windows.
- Labor Complexity: Installation complexity depends on existing window condition, wall structure, and accessibility, influencing labor time and effort.
- Permitting: Local permits may be required for window replacements, especially if structural modifications are involved or if new openings are created.
- Additional Options: Extras such as custom finishes, hardware upgrades, or energy-efficient glazing can be included to enhance functionality and appearance.
